Transaction 3e856e8458dc947d53a58310cf2143ab9a7542704388cc70351a5d9a986939f0
1 Input
2 Outputs
- 3e856e8458dc947d53a58310cf2143ab9a7542704388cc70351a5d9a986939f0:0
- 3e856e8458dc947d53a58310cf2143ab9a7542704388cc70351a5d9a986939f0:1
value 901191
address 1FjkgLNNwv38S7vYUMpf4NTpoLuYNhjd4T
value 2104800
address 36EbCdVyQqSeutfhF7PFBSoP6cH5sG1pU7